首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ux控制台切换

基础概念

Linux控制台切换是指在Linux操作系统中,用户可以在不同的终端(Terminal)或控制台(Console)之间进行切换。Linux系统通常支持多个虚拟控制台(Virtual Console),每个控制台可以独立运行一个终端会话。

类型

  1. 物理控制台:通过键盘上的Ctrl+Alt+F1Ctrl+Alt+F6(通常是6个)可以切换到不同的物理控制台。
  2. 虚拟控制台:通过Ctrl+Alt+F7通常可以返回到图形界面(如果系统配置了图形界面)。
  3. 终端模拟器:在图形界面中,可以使用终端模拟器(如GNOME Terminal、Konsole等)来打开多个终端窗口。

应用场景

  • 多任务处理:在不同的控制台之间切换可以同时进行多个任务,例如在一个控制台运行服务器进程,在另一个控制台进行调试。
  • 系统管理:在进行系统维护或故障排除时,切换到不同的控制台可以更方便地查看系统日志或执行命令。
  • 多用户环境:在多用户环境中,每个用户可以在不同的控制台上独立工作,互不干扰。

优势

  • 资源隔离:每个控制台可以独立运行进程,互不影响。
  • 灵活性:可以根据需要切换到不同的控制台进行不同的操作。
  • 历史记录:每个控制台都有自己的命令历史记录,方便用户回顾和重复使用之前的命令。

常见问题及解决方法

问题:为什么无法切换到其他控制台?

原因

  1. 权限问题:某些系统配置可能限制了用户切换控制台的能力。
  2. 键盘映射问题:键盘上的Ctrl+Alt+F1Ctrl+Alt+F6可能被其他程序占用或重新映射。
  3. 系统配置问题:系统可能没有正确配置虚拟控制台。

解决方法

  1. 检查权限:确保当前用户有权限切换控制台。可以使用sudo命令提升权限。
  2. 检查权限:确保当前用户有权限切换控制台。可以使用sudo命令提升权限。
  3. 检查键盘映射:确保没有其他程序占用了Ctrl+Alt+F1Ctrl+Alt+F6。可以尝试重启系统或检查键盘配置文件。
  4. 检查系统配置:确保系统配置文件(如/etc/inittab/etc/systemd/logind.conf)正确配置了虚拟控制台。
  5. 检查系统配置:确保系统配置文件(如/etc/inittab/etc/systemd/logind.conf)正确配置了虚拟控制台。

问题:如何在图形界面中打开新的终端?

解决方法

  1. 使用快捷键:在大多数Linux桌面环境中,可以使用Ctrl+Alt+T快捷键打开新的终端窗口。
  2. 通过应用程序菜单:在桌面环境的菜单中找到“终端”或“Terminal”选项,点击打开新的终端窗口。

示例代码

以下是一个简单的示例,展示如何在Linux控制台中切换:

代码语言:txt
复制
# 切换到控制台1
Ctrl+Alt+F1

# 在控制台1中运行命令
ls -l

# 切换回图形界面(通常是控制台7)
Ctrl+Alt+F7

参考链接

希望这些信息对你有所帮助!如果有更多具体问题,欢迎继续提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券